E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
无源锁
java学习.五
Collections工具类1.Collections的常用方法三、编程练习(1)数组练习1.矩阵顺时针打印2.矩阵查找某个值(快捷法)(2)StringJoiner练习1.练习(3)集合统一练习1.扑克牌的洗牌、发牌(
无
排序
羽沢31
·
2025-03-05 01:28
学习
Wireshark LUA脚本分析自定义帧格式
帧格式该帧格式由课设要求引出,本次课设要求在eth0网络接口与Linux内核TCP/IP间串接一个虚拟网络接口vni0,如下图所示:此报文格式修改为下图所示:以太帧头部:目的MAC地址(6字节)=广播MAC地址;
源
MAC
sh1t灬
·
2025-03-05 01:25
lua
wireshark
开发语言
单源最短路径
目录
无
负权单源最短路径迪杰斯特拉算法(dijkstra)朴素版迪杰斯特拉小根堆优化版本dijkstra有负权的图的单源最短路径SPFA总结
无
负权单源最短路径在处理图论相关问题时,经常会遇到求一点到其他点的最短距离是多少的问题
陵易居士
·
2025-03-05 00:47
数据结构与算法
算法
图论
线程+线程池
在同一时间需要完成多项任务的时候2、创建线程的三种方式继承Thread类实现Runnable接口实现Callable接口创建方式使用场景Thread单继承Runnable
无
返回值任务Callable有返回值任务
gordon~9
·
2025-03-04 23:44
java
java
线程
线程池
什么是预训练?
一、介绍预训练模型诞生背景:对于某种特殊任务只存在少量的相关训练数据,以至于模型不能从中学习到有用的规律(标注资源稀缺,
无
大数据支持)举例:想对一批法律领域的文件进行关系抽取,就需要投入大量的精力(意味着时间和金钱的大量投入
卡卡大怪兽
·
2025-03-04 23:44
自然语言处理
【数据库】小白也能看懂的MySQL索引底层数据结构(深度解析)
想要找到一瓶可乐,有两种方式:
无
索引模式:逐个货架检查(全表扫描),耗时30分钟有索引模式:查看商品分布图→饮料区→碳酸饮料货架(索引查询),耗时2分钟1.索引的底层结构与原理1.1为什么需要索引?
千益
·
2025-03-04 23:10
数据库
数据库
mysql
数据结构
全方位解析双 Token实现
无
感刷新:用 Spring Boot + Vue + Redis 构建高安全认证体系
前言:随着Web应用需求的增加,如何保障用户数据和信息的安全,成为了开发者关注的重要问题。传统的单Token认证方法虽然简便,但在长时间使用或高频请求下,可能带来一定的安全隐患。双Token身份认证机制提供了一种更加安全且高效的方式,本文将详细介绍如何在SpringBoot和Vue中实现双Token认证。同时在单token进行操作时,也会遇到token到期而需要频繁登录的问题,使用双token就能
小菜不菜。
·
2025-03-04 22:37
spring
boot
vue.js
ux
智能化 SQL 生成与数据校验自动化:测试数据对比的终极解决方案
数据
源
多样化(如JSON接口返回值、CSV文件、数据库查询结果等),手动对比效率低下且容易遗漏。校验逻辑复杂,难以快速找出差异,差异报告缺乏清晰的可视化。这些问题不仅耗费精力,还容易导致测试周期延长。
Python测试之道
·
2025-03-04 22:34
测试提效
python
python
深度学习
DeepSeek
稳定运行的以Redshift数据仓库为数据
源
和目标的ETL性能变差时提高性能方法和步骤
当以AmazonRedshift数据仓库为数据
源
和目标的ETL(Extract,Transform,Load)性能变差时,可能涉及多个方面的优化措施。
weixin_30777913
·
2025-03-04 22:04
数据仓库
云计算
通过spark-redshift工具包读取redshift上的表
spark数据
源
API在spark1.2以后,开始提供插件诗的机制,并与各种结构化数据
源
整合。
stark_summer
·
2025-03-04 22:02
spark
spark
redshift
parquet
api
数据
Windows逆向工程入门之MASM 选择结构
公开视频->链接点击跳转公开课程博客首页->链接点击跳转博客主页目录一、标志寄存器1.1核心标志位功能详解二、条件跳转指令系统分类2.1
无
符号数跳转指令集2.2有符号数跳转指令集2.3特殊检测指令三、MASM
0xCC说逆向
·
2025-03-04 21:25
windows
汇编
安全
逆向
病毒
Linux----进程间的通信
进程间通信之信号:信号--软中断中断信号---中断
源
中断(信号)处理程序---负责对该中断(信号)做出反应的//信号处理函数的注册函数#includetypedefvoid(*sighandler_t)
weixin_51790712
·
2025-03-04 20:23
linux
运维
服务器
redis分布式
锁
的原理与实现【分布式】
文章目录前言一、什么是分布式
锁
1、原理2、场景二、redis实现分布式
锁
1、redis实现分布式
锁
原理2、Lock函数的实现3、实际使用三、redis实现分布式
锁
出现的经典问题死锁问题问题锁不住与删除别人
锁
问题锁不住问题解决
UPUP小亮
·
2025-03-04 20:52
分布式系统架构
redis
分布式
数据库
缓存
golang
IP地址伪造和反伪造技术
IP地址伪造的基本原理主要是攻击者通过修改数据包中的
源
IP地址字段,使其显示为其他合法或非法的IP地址。
·
2025-03-04 18:07
ipip地址ip伪造
JAVA单服务应用拆分成多个服务的实践(3)--前端的nginx转发
前端只认一个,就使用nginx的转发,将特定的请求转发到微服务的接口里,让前端
无
感请求到到另一服务中。nginx的配置如下
秤秤biubiu
·
2025-03-04 18:02
开发(应用软件
网站相关)
niginx
【本地化部署Stable Diffusion WebUI(MACOS安装)】
如何生成可参考右边的帮助文档文章目录前言一、StableDiffusionWebUI适配三类芯片二、安装1.安装git、conda等2.选定目录及下载Github远程仓库文件3.创建conda虚拟环境4.安装依赖pip速度慢需添加国内pip
源
5
大漠新人
·
2025-03-04 18:32
stable
diffusion
macos
AI作画
分布式系统必备:使用 Redis 实现分布式
锁
的实战指南
分布式系统必备:使用Redis实现分布式
锁
的实战指南前言在分布式系统中,协调多个服务实例对共享资源的访问是一个常见且棘手的问题。
全栈探索者chen
·
2025-03-04 17:55
redis
redis
分布式
数据库
深度学习
数据分析
性能优化
安全
[杂学笔记]面向对象特性、右值引用与移动语义、push_back与emplace_back的区别、读写
锁
与智能指针对
锁
的管理、访问网站的全过程
1.面向对象特性面向对象的三大特性分别是封装、继承与多态,这三个特性的前提就是C++引入了类与对象的概念。封装指的就是将数据和函数方法进行包裹起来,对外部隐藏类对象的实现细节,只提供一些公共接口来和对象进行交互。好处在于将数据私有化,防止外部代码随意的访问和修改数据。继承是指一个类可以继承另一个类的属性和方法内容,并且可以再此基础之上添加新的属性和方法,或者重定义父类的属性和方法。继承可以实现代码
北顾南栀倾寒
·
2025-03-04 17:25
笔记
网络
c++
stl
go-redis实现分布式
锁
go-redis实现分布式
锁
介绍默认阻塞在这种情况下只进行一次尝试获取
锁
,失败就停止了。自旋锁在这个模式下,会尝试获取
锁
,当失败后会尝试自旋不断的尝试,直到获取了
锁
。
kobayashiii
·
2025-03-04 17:24
golang
redis
无
重复字符子串
实例:输入:s="abcabcbb"输出:3解释:因为
无
重复字符的最长子串是“abc”,所以其长度为3解析:采用哈希表来进行匹配,通过滑动窗口,记录滑动窗口的最大长度即可class Solution {
lays03
·
2025-03-04 15:43
代码
算法
leetcode
算法
职场和发展
LeetCode49:字母异位词分组
字母异位词是由重新排列
源
单词的所有字母得到的一个新单词。
向阳1218
·
2025-03-04 15:12
leetcode
算法
leetcode
14个Flink SQL性能优化实践分享
1.常见性能问题1.1数据
源
读取效率低并行度不足:默认的并行度可能无法充分利用硬件资源。--设置并行度SET'parallelism.default'=16;1.2状
快乐非自愿
·
2025-03-04 15:40
flink
sql
性能优化
【AI】手把手教你用Dify+Agent搭建数据查询AI应用,实现自然语言流畅的和AI对话,
无
感切换数据
源
!大模型|LLM|Agent
手把手教你用Dify+Agent搭建数据查询AI应用,实现自然语言流畅的和AI对话,
无
感切换数据
源
!大模型|LLM|Agent一、为何选择Agent?
厦门德仔
·
2025-03-04 15:39
AI
人工智能
服务器
运维
无
重复字符的最长子串
LeetCode热题100|3.
无
重复字符的最长子串大家好,今天我们来解决一道经典的算法题——
无
重复字符的最长子串。
_Itachi__
·
2025-03-04 14:04
LeetCode
leetcode
算法
职场和发展
docker部署stable-diffusion-webui
大模型弄好了,想着玩玩stable-diffusion-webui,结果折腾了几天
无
果,最后使用大佬的docker镜像弄好了。
特制蛋炒饭
·
2025-03-04 13:57
docker
stable
diffusion
容器
Redis存储⑮Redis的应用_分布式
锁
_Lua脚本/Redlock算法
目录1.分布式
锁
的概念2.分布式
锁
的实现3.过期时间4.校验id5.Lua脚本6.watchdog(看门狗)7.Redlock算法8.其他功能1.分布式
锁
的概念在一个分布式的系统中,也会涉及到多个节点访问同一个公共资源的情况
GR鲸鱼
·
2025-03-04 13:53
Redis存储
分布式
redis
缓存
数据库
两轮车
无
钥匙启动系统
两轮车
无
钥匙进入一键启动系统主要通过RFID无线射频技术和车辆身份编码识别系统实现,用户只需携带智能钥匙靠近车辆,系统会自动感应并解除防盗,按下启动按钮即可启动车辆,无需插钥匙。
zsmydz888
·
2025-03-04 12:49
摩托车一键启动
车联网解决方案
人工智能
.NET 9 优化,抢先体验 C# 13 新特性
目录前言新特性Params集合
锁
对象索引器改进部分属性方法组自然类型ref和unsafe在async方法和迭代器中的使用总结下载地址最后前言微软即将在2024年11月12日发布.NET9的最终版本,而08
小码编匠
·
2025-03-04 12:16
.NET
.net
c#
开发语言
Linux之系统之配置HAProxy负载均衡服务器
主要特点1.3使用场景二、本次实践介绍2.1本次实践简介2.2本次实践环境规划三、部署两台web服务器3.1运行两个Docker容器3.2编辑测试文件3.3访问测试四、安装HAProxy4.1更新系统软件
源
4.2
江湖有缘
·
2025-03-04 11:41
Linux技术学习
服务器
linux
负载均衡
最节省成本的架构方案:
无
服务器架构
无
服务器架构(ServerlessArchitecture)是一种颠覆性的云计算执行模型,它允许开发者专注于编写和部署代码,而无需担心底层服务器基础设施的管理。
fxrz12
·
2025-03-04 11:40
无服务
云计算
个人博客
架构
云原生
serverless
期权帮|沪深300股指期货合约技巧有哪些?
沪深300指数的交易时间是上午9:30至11:30,下午13:00至15:00,
无
夜盘交易。一、沪深300指数的技术分析:(1)移动平均线:用于判断市场趋势,短期均线(如5日均线)上穿
qiquandongkh
·
2025-03-04 10:29
区块链
大数据
金融
MySQL 之并发控制(Concurrent Control in MySQL)
1.5.1锁机制
锁
类型
锁
类型说明读
锁
共享
锁
,也称为S
锁
,只读不可写(包括当前事务),多个读互不阻塞写
锁
独占
锁
,排它锁,也称为X
锁
,写
锁
会阻塞其它事务(不包括当前事务)的读和写S
锁
和S
锁
是兼容的,X
锁
和其它
锁
都不兼容
Linux运维老纪
·
2025-03-04 09:25
用心耕耘
开启数据库之门
mysql
数据库
运维开发
云计算
java.util.concurrent.locks 包中的接口和实现类
但是synchronized有以下缺陷:不支持公平性,在synchronized中,
锁
一旦释放,任何等待中的线程都有机会去获取该
锁
。这可能导致其中一个线程一直获取到
锁
资源,而其他线程长时间
无
XeonYu
·
2025-03-04 09:53
juc
locks
ReadWriteLock
Condition
Lock
juc
Java 多线程进阶:常见的
锁
策略/synchronized原理/CAS/JUC(java.util.concurrent)的常见类/线程安全的集合类
一.常见的
锁
策略
锁
:非常广义的话题;synchronized:只是市面上五花八门的
锁
的其中一种典型的实现,Java内置的推荐使用的
锁
;(1)乐观
锁
&&悲观
锁
乐观
锁
:加锁的时候,假设出现
锁
冲突的概率不大;
用屁屁笑
·
2025-03-04 09:53
java
开发语言
ConcurrentHashMap 原理与优化
###一、并发容器的设计哲学并发容器的设计旨在解决传统集合类在多线程环境下的线程安全问题,同时尽可能减少
锁
竞争带来的性能
hummhumm
·
2025-03-04 07:15
开发语言
运维
java
数据库
java-ee
深入理解Java并发编程(一):揭秘并发性能优化的底层机制
为了更深入地理解Java并发编程,本文将详细讲解程序上下文切换、volatile关键字、Java对象头、synchronized
锁
升级和原子操作的原理与应用,并通过代码示例和图表帮助读者更好地掌握这些知识
西瓜拍两瓣
·
2025-03-04 07:43
java
性能优化
开发语言
jvm
笔记
Qt弹出式窗口、Qt::popup闪退问题、设置窗口
无
焦点问题
需求根据业务需求,在输入框(QlineEdit)下面做一个模糊查找的弹窗(PopupWidget),当鼠标点击弹窗以外的地方时,这个窗口关闭,当光标在输入框重新输入内容时,再次弹框。实现方法方法一在网上查找到的方法;设置窗口标志位:setWindowFlags(Qt::FramelessWindowHint|Qt::Popup);此方法可以达到弹出式窗口的效果,但是出现了一个致命的问题,但我再次s
马斯尔果
·
2025-03-04 06:31
QT
qt
matlab实现转换音频格式文件,mp3到wav的转换
准备数据下载的音频文件:开源https://voice.mozilla.org/zh-CN/datasets问题是该音频文件
无
扩展名(格式为MP3)如何实现批量在文件后面添加扩展名.mp3?
heda3
·
2025-03-04 06:30
信号处理算法实战解析
格式转换
MP3
到
wav
matlab
opencv调用 cv::imshow()卡死,未响应
如果cv::imshow()
无
作用需要调用cv::waitKey()
Lj2_jOker
·
2025-03-04 05:59
opencv
计算机视觉
人工智能
linux系统监控shell脚本
1232.设置时间同步①配置文件修改cp/etc/chrony.conf/etc/chrony.conf_defaultvi/etc/chrony.conf修改server即可,删掉其他的,添加要同步时间的
源
服务器
·
2025-03-04 05:16
shell系统监控
python如何教你开发抢票程序
使用python实现韩国抢票,自动排队,自动下单,自动
锁
票,自动支付defblockInit_v2(proxyConfig=None):globalfirsttry:#遍历区域抢购信息,print(“创建订单
WX:saferland
·
2025-03-04 04:48
python
课程设计
爬虫
vue a-table 实现指定字段相同数据合并行
vuea-table实现相同数据合并行实现效果代码实现cloums数据格式数据
源
格式合并代码实现效果代码实现cloums数据格式constgetColumns=function(){return[{title
跳跳的小古风
·
2025-03-04 04:47
Vue
vue.js
javascript
ecmascript
MoneyPrinterTurbo – 开源的AI短视频生成工具
MoneyPrinterTurbo兼容多种AI模型,确保视频素材高清
无
牛马尼格
·
2025-03-04 03:45
人工智能
人工智能
pixel5刷面具卡在fastboot后的恢复过程
今天真是一波三折先介绍一下,刷面具的话oem得开起来,开不了的没法刷然后就是开bl
锁
,去搜一下rom乐园adb工具,我是用那个开的大概的命令就是adbdevices查看设备,然后就是根据那个adb工具下载文档操作不做赘述然后就是刷面具了
无极工作室(网络安全)
·
2025-03-04 03:14
安全性测试
网络安全应急响应中主机历史命令被删除 网络安全事件应急响应
17.1网络安全应急响应概述“居安思危,思则有备,有备
无
患。”网络安全应急响应是针对潜在发生的网络安全事件而采取的网络安全措施。
网安墨雨
·
2025-03-04 03:12
web安全
网络
安全
数据库事务
锁
的核心实现逻辑
背景对于一些内部使用的管理系统来说,可能没有引入Redis,又想基于现有的基础设施处理并发问题,而数据库是每个应用都避不开的基础设施之一,因此分享个我曾经维护过的一个系统中,使用数据库表来实现事务
锁
的方式
试着奔跑的菜鸟
·
2025-03-04 03:11
系统设计
java
经验分享
java
高并发
分布式锁
奏响青春的乐章
壮丽的乐谱在你、在我、在他的心中奏响,奏响专属于每个人独一
无
二的乐章。
大丈夫在世当日食一鲲
·
2025-03-04 02:32
征文活动
360个人版和企业版的区别
功能方面管理能力个人版:主要用于单台设备的安全防护,只能在单独的电脑上进行安装使用,
无
集中管理和监控其他设备的功能。企业版:可批量管理大量电脑,如公司的十台、百台甚至千台电脑。
小魚資源大雜燴
·
2025-03-04 02:02
网络
windows
Flutter-防京东商城项目-状态管理 多页面数据共享-23
代码文档Flutter防京东商城源码(1-10)链接Flutter防京东商城源码(11-20)链接Flutter防京东商城源码(21-30)链接Flutter防京东商城
源
冯汉栩
·
2025-03-04 02:31
Flutter
flutter
第六周:你推崇的领导方式是怎么样的
1.你所推崇的领导方式“君子有诸己而后求诸人,
无
诸己而后非诸人。”我所推崇的领导方式,应该是以身作则,不会要求别人做我自己做不到的事情,当然,也不会强求他人做我自己可以做到的事情。
·
2025-03-04 02:40
程序员
上一页
10
11
12
13
14
15
16
17
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他